The battle for the right to build a new house for his ailing wife Irene (Geneviève Bujold) is almost becoming ridiculous because the government keeps demanding compliance with the building laws without even checking the house. He decides to build a new house that caring for her can be more manageable but he has to battle a government bureaucrat (Jonathan Potts). Martins, New Brunswick and he is a farmer living with a wife losing her memory. Written and directed by Michael McGowan based on a true story, the film stars James Cromwell as Craig Morrison. This was unexpectedly gorgeous Canadian romantic drama which was originally released under the title Still at the 2012 Toronto International Film Festival.
